The Revival of Polo in Kashmir: Sport of Kings

Polo, known as the sport of kings, has a long and rich history that dates back over 2000 years. Originating in ancient Persia, it quickly spread across the world, becoming popular in countries like India, England, and Argentina. In recent years, there has been a remarkable revival of polo in the picturesque region of Kashmir, India. This resurgence not only showcases the beauty and grace of the sport but also highlights the cultural significance of polo in Kashmiri society.

The Historical Significance of Polo in Kashmir

The presence of polo in Kashmir can be traced back to the 15th century when it was introduced by Sultan Zain-ul-Abidin, popularly known as Budshah. The sport gained immense popularity among the royalty and the nobility, who considered it an essential part of their lifestyle. Polo matches were not just about showcasing athletic prowess but were also grand spectacles that brought communities together.

During the British Raj, polo in Kashmir gained even more prominence. The British officers stationed in the region were avid polo players, and they actively encouraged the locals to take up the sport. The sport became an integral part of the social fabric of Kashmir, with matches being held regularly and drawing large crowds.

The Decline and the Resurgence

Unfortunately, the turbulent times in Kashmir during the late 20th century led to a decline in polo's popularity. Political unrest and the ongoing conflict dampened the spirit of the sport, and many polo grounds were abandoned or converted for other uses. The once-thriving polo culture seemed to be fading away.

However, in recent years, there has been a renewed interest in reviving the polo tradition in Kashmir. Local communities, along with government authorities, have come together to promote the sport and rejuvenate the polo infrastructure. Polo tournaments are now being organized across the region, attracting both local and international players. These events not only promote sportsmanship but also help to create a positive image for Kashmir.

Promoting Tourism and Cultural Exchange

The revival of polo in Kashmir has also played a crucial role in promoting tourism in the region. Visitors from all over the world are now flocking to witness the matches and experience the unique blend of history, culture, and natural beauty that Kashmir has to offer. Polo tournaments are not just about the sport; they are also vibrant cultural events that showcase the rich heritage of Kashmiri traditions.

In addition to promoting tourism, polo has also become a platform for cultural exchange. International players who participate in tournaments in Kashmir get a chance to interact with the local community, fostering understanding and friendship. The sport acts as a bridge between different cultures, bringing people together through a shared passion.
